For flexwatt I'd probably get a 12" square for the size cage you're working with. It's essentially the same thing as a UTH just less expensive and without a bunch of extra packaging around it. You just tape it to the bottom of the enclosure with foil tape, thermostat probe between the flexwatt and the bottom of the cage and set the temperature at about 90*. Should be fine on that cabinet but make sure to put some furniture pads or something on the bottom corners of the cage to make sure there the cord doesn't get pinched and to ensure some ventilation. UTH generally come with spacers/feet to put on the corners of the cage but flexwatt will come as is. Try out reptilebasics.com for flexwatt.
